## **Documentation requirements for J1815** As with any procedure, especially involving injecting drugs into patients, it's important to document the following before you file for a claim that includes this code: - The full name of the personnel who administered the injection + their credentials - The name and address of the facility where the injection was administered - The full name of the patient - The dates and times of the administration by injection - Patient records showing their diabetes diagnosis and related conditions and symptoms - Records of insulin products that the patient uses - Records of their blood glucose levels - The exact dosage(s) of the insulin shots ## **Billing requirements for J1815** Besides the documentation requirements above, please note the following billing requirements for this HCPCS code: - They must reflect the dosage given over the course of the treatment
